Subject: BEIJING AIRPORT- Gateway to the Olympics!
Content: BEIJING AIRPORT   Cost a reported 27 Billion Yuan ($3.65 Billion) Took less than 4 years to build During construction had 50,000 workers on site Floor Area 1.3 Million Square Metres Over 4 Km Long WhichMakes It The Worlds Largest Building Has an Automated People Mover (A P M) which travels at 80 k/hr Has 84 shops and over 100 restaurants Terminal 3's curved roof contains thousands of skylights. Their orientation to the southeast is intended to maximize the heat gain from the early morning sun, helping to reduce the amount of energy expended by the structure for heating.
